Description

A semi-lightweight, medium width, TrueType Unicode font for Latin and polytonic Greek characters. The Latin characters are upright, the Greek slightly italicised. May not display correctly in Internet Explorer.

From the project website (accessed 2017-11-07):

This font is free for personal and academic use. It may be used in a dissertation or thesis, but may not be used in any other publication without express written permission. It may not be decompiled, reverse-engineered, or altered in any way.
